Yes, there are definitely more options if you're creating the pdf directly
(e.g. you could just create the PdfAction and assign it to whatever chunk
you want).

In our case, the pdf reports already exist, so we have to use a stamper,
which doesn't access the primary content layer - so adding annotations on
top is the only option.
